What Is an AI-Native ERP System?

An AI-native ERP is built with artificial intelligence at its core—not added later. These systems use:

  • Machine learning for forecasting and recommendations
  • Intelligent automation for workflows
  • Real-time analytics for decision-making
  • Predictive insights across finance, inventory, sales, and operations

Unlike traditional ERP systems, AI-native platforms continuously learn and improve over time.


The Hidden Cost of Manual and Legacy ERP Systems

Many SMEs still rely on spreadsheets, disconnected software, or outdated ERP platforms. This leads to:

  • Manual data entry and errors
  • Delayed reporting
  • Limited business visibility
  • Higher operational costs
  • Slow decision-making

These inefficiencies quietly drain profits and limit growth potential.

Inventory Optimization and Noticeable Cost Reduction

AI-driven inventory management helps SMEs:

  • Predict demand accurately
  • Avoid overstocking and stock-outs
  • Automate reordering
  • Reduce holding costs

ROI Impact

  • Lower inventory carrying costs
  • Improved cash flow
  • Higher order fulfillment rates

For retail, manufacturing, and distribution SMEs, this alone can justify the investment.

Lower Total Cost of Ownership (TCO)

Cloud-based AI-native ERP systems eliminate many hidden costs:

  • No on-premise hardware
  • Reduced IT maintenance
  • Automatic updates
  • Subscription-based pricing

ROI Impact

  • Predictable expenses
  • Reduced upfront investment
  • Faster payback period

SMEs gain enterprise-level capabilities at affordable costs.
